Amy Hamm: Tribunal punishes doc for conscientious objection to puberty blockers

The claimant was seeking $50,000 for the professed purpose of “making discrimination against transgender children in health care expensive.” The claimant also wanted the BCHRT decision to be “prominently” posted, in perpetuity, anywhere the physician works. Surprisingly, Devyn Cousineau, who wrote the decision, agreed with the impugned physician that this “would serve no purpose other than to punish him.” (Apparently publishing his name, fining him and demanding that he provide “gender-affirming care” in the future, under legal threat, was punishment enough.)
